Amelia Quebrada Seca Vineyard Chardonnay 2018

Category: White Wines
Sub-Category:   White Wines
Producer: Amelia
Label Name: Quebrada Seca Vineyard Chardonnay
Vintage: 2018
Country: Chile
Region: Limarí Valley (Quebrada Seca)
Volume: 750ml
ABV: 13.5%
Grape(s): 100% Chardonnay
Acidity: 4
Sweetness: 1
Body: 4
Length: 4
Aroma Intensity: 4
Best Temperature: 10-12°C

Awards/Ratings

Descorchados 2020 — 97 pts (Best White & Best Chardonnay of Chile); Wine Advocate — 95 pts (2018); Tim Atkin — 97 pts; James Suckling — 94; Decanter/other critics 94–96 pts


Tasting Note

Bright, crystalline yellow with aromas of white flowers, pear, citrus and flint; chalky lemon and green-apple on the palate, vibrant acidity, creamy texture and a saline, long mineral finish.


Food Pairing

Western: seared tuna with sesame, grilled sea bass, lobster bisque, seafood paella, scallops, salmon-stuffed ravioli, roasted Cornish game hen. Asian: sushi/sashimi, miso‑glazed cod, teriyaki salmon, Thai coconut prawn curry, sesame tuna.


Production Method

Hand-harvested Chardonnay from Quebrada Seca; barrel-fermented and aged ~12 months in French oak (≈18% new), minimal malolactic to preserve freshness, light lees contact for texture.


Vineyard Info

Amelia is Concha y Toro’s ultra‑premium bottling (launched 1993) from the Quebrada Seca vineyard (190 m, 22 km from the Pacific) on clay soils rich in calcium carbonate; winemaker Marcelo Papa.
